Fika - a word derived and rearranged from the Swedish word for coffee (kaffe) was adapted in the early 20th century to the popular culture, soon after coffee was no longer prohibited by the government.Yes, coffee was illegal during the ruling of King Gustav III and even after the King's death in 1792, officials wanted to hold on to coffees' banned status.

One for the chocaholic, the ' kladdkaka ' is another Swedish classic. Kladdkaka, which translates to "sticky cake", is in a gooey class of its own (it beats a brownie any day). The richness of the chocolate is perfectly balanced with whipped cream and/or a handful of fresh berries.

Nowadays, the Swedes generally take two fika breaks a day: once in the mid-morning, and again around 3 p.m. The word fika actually derives from the 19th-century slang word for coffee, kaffi.

Fika, to Swedes, is not a random act, but a ritualistic experience. While it customarily involves coffee and a delicious pastry, the fundamental essence of fika lies in consciously taking a break from the humdrum of life, together with others. It presents an opportunity to unwind and strengthen social connections, whether with family, friends.
